Inspiron E1505 Wireless not working.
I did a fresh install (XP Media Center 2005) on my Inspiron E1505 and installed the drivers on the cd that appeared to be for my system.
The Quickset WIFI catcher radio configuration window when opened from the icon on the taskbar is grayed out where I should be able to select the network.
The following items in hardware have the question mark and am not sure what drivers I need. Like I said I used the drivers cd and installed them in the correct order.
Base system devices listed 3 times
network controller
The onboard lan is in hardware and working so network controller it is not refering to the onboard lan.
any ideas on this?

Well, lets get you some drivers for those ones giving you problems in the device manager first.
The 3 Base System Devices is most likely a Ricoh Card Reader Install the media card reader driver from support.dell.com or by inserting the ResourceCD. If you are installing from the CD, choose Windows XP>System Devices>Ricoh R5C832 5-in-1 Card Reader.
And the network controller is the probably cause to the icon being greyed out as it is a wireless controller. Install the wireless driver from support.dell.com or by inserting the ResourceCD. If you are installing from the CD, choose Windows XP>Network Drivers>Dell Wireless 1390/1490 Mini-Card Driver or the Intel 3945 Mini-Card Wireless Driver.
